Previous studies show that the exposure to tobacco smoke during the early postnatal period interferes with processes related to the brain development. Thus, the aim of this study was to assess whether the exposure to nicotine during the early postnatal period has an effect on the behavioural sensitization to nicotine during adulthood. For this reason, male Swiss mice were exposed to nicotine between the postnatal day (PN 4) and (PN 17) by osmotic mini pumps implanted in the mothers (8 mg/kg/day). In the adulthood, the mice were treated with nicotine (1 mg/kg, i.p.) or saline solution for seven alternate days (D1, D3, D5, D7, D9 e D13) to acquire sensitization. On the third day of abstinence, the elevated plus-maze test was performed to evaluate anxiety. In D18 the mice were challenged with saline or nicotine. After the behavioural tests, the animals were euthanized and the c-Fos, Synapsin I and PSD-95 proteins were quantified by Western blot in different brain structures. There was a decrease in locomotor activity in animals that received nicotine in D1 when compared to those that received saline. The animals in the SAL postnatal NIC/NIC groups showed an increased locomotor activity between D1 and D13, while the animals in the NIC postnatal NIC/NIC group showed an increased locomotor activity between D1 and D13 and between D1 and the day of the challenge. In the elevated plus maze test, animals in the NIC postnatal NIC/NIC group showed an increase in the time and in the number of open arms entries compared to animals in the SAL postnatal NIC/NIC group in addition to a decrease in rearing compared to animals that received saline in adulthood. The results show that there was a decrease in the c-Fos levels in the cerebellum and striatum in the NIC postnatal SAL/SAL, SAL postnatal NIC/NIC, and NIC postnatal NIC/NIC when compared with SAL postnatal SAL/SAL. The results show that the dose of nicotine used during adulthood was not able to induce a behavioural sensitization although the exposure to nicotine in the early postnatal period contributed to the increase in the locomotor activity on the day of the challenge and to the decrease in anxiety during the withdrawal period.
